Director of Membership Operations
Reporting to the EVP of Membership, the Director of Membership Operations is responsible for providing strategic leadership and oversight of all membership operations functions, including gift processing, data management, reporting, and operational systems. This role ensures that donor contributions are processed accurately and that all membership systems and workflows effectively support WABE's multichannel fundraising efforts, which include radio, television, podcasts, digital platforms, direct mail, email, targeted advertising, telephone, texting, and other strategies designed to retain and deepen donor relationships.
The successful candidate will bring expertise in fundraising operations, data analytics and reporting, prospect research, and project management. They should be highly proficient with the Microsoft Office suite and possess experience in CRM administration, gift processing, reconciliation, and process improvement. Additional desirable qualifications include financial management experience, familiarity with nonprofit or media environments, and the ability to collaborate effectively across departments to support organizational and fundraising objectives.
- Provide strategic leadership and direction for Membership Operations, including oversight of the Operations Manager and all operational functions.Optimize workflows, processes, and technology platforms to ensure efficient, high quality day to day operations across the department.Oversee service delivery to ensure consistent, accurate, and donor centric interactions across all operational touchpoints. Break down departmental silos and ensure Membership Operations is fully aligned with organizational goals, fundraising strategy, and cross departmental priorities. Lead reporting, metrics analysis, and compliance with industry standards, internal controls, and regulatory requirements. Oversee all aspects of gift processing—including cash handling, gift and pledge entry, transaction adjustments, imports, and reconciliations—while upholding industry best practices and WABE specific gift policies. Guide the entry and maintenance of donor interests, attributes, and segmentation data to support targeted fundraising and marketing initiatives. Integrate prospect research into membership operations by ensuring that donor profiles, giving histories, research insights, and wealth indicators are accurately maintained and utilized to support major giving, planned giving, and membership strategies. Partner with fundraising colleagues to provide prospecting support, including identifying potential donors, tracking engagement activity, and preparing research reports that strengthen cultivation and stewardship efforts. Continuously evaluate and enhance gift processing and prospect data procedures to improve accuracy, efficiency, and strategic opportunity identification. Apply knowledge of membership giving levels, campaigns, and special donor programs to ensure proper attribution, coding, and reporting of gifts. Partner closely with Finance and other internal teams to reconcile all gifts, confirm receipt of wire and stock transfers, and resolve discrepancies. Identify, troubleshoot, and resolve issues or data inconsistencies that may impact timely gift processing, donor acknowledgment, or prospect research integrity. Perform additional leadership responsibilities assigned to support organizational and departmental objectives.
